Short-Term Rental Success: A Host's Guide
Achieving steady profitability in the short-term letting market demands more than just listing your space online; it requires a strategic approach. A successful host knows the importance of creating a welcoming and spotless environment for travelers. Think about investing in professional pictures to showcase your listing at its best, as first impressions are incredibly key. Beyond aesthetics, outstanding communication – prompt responses to inquiries and customized attention to guest needs – can significantly impact feedback and repeat bookings. Furthermore, keeping abreast of local regulations and pricing trends is essential for maximizing your income and ensuring a easy operation. Don't ignore the power of thoughtful touches, such as providing regional guides or basic amenities to enhance the guest visit.
Enhancing Your Vacation Income as an Vacation Rental Host
To truly maximize your earnings as a Airbnb host, a proactive approach is necessary. Analyze pricing your property dynamically, adjusting rates based on peak times and local attractions. Furthermore, allocating in high-quality photography and detailed descriptions can significantly entice more ideal guests. Don't underestimate the importance of remarkable guest service; efficient replies and a welcoming touch can encourage positive reviews. Exploring the Transient Rental Landscape
The vacation rental business is a evolving arena, and successfully tackling it requires more than just listing a accommodation online. Recent regulations, variable demand, and increasing rivalry create both possibilities and difficulties for owners. Staying aware about state laws – which can change drastically – is critical. Furthermore, setting rates competitively, keeping exceptional guest experiences, and carefully handling maintenance are all necessary components of a profitable short-term rental business. Consider dedicating time in knowing best practices or seeking professional advice to improve your outcomes and reduce potential issues.
